Avoid regular short journeys
Short car journeys are known to be bad for your car battery, as they prevent the battery from fully charging. To prevent this, try to drive your car frequently and for longer periods of time. Why not group all of your errands into one journey where possible?
Test your new car battery often
Keeping an eye on your battery and testing it frequently, or whenever you can will encourage a long lifetime. Once a month test your car battery’s output voltage level with a car battery tester to keep track of how well your battery is performing or whether you would benefit from a replacement.
